LUBBOCK, Texas — On Wednesday, the Lubbock Police Department identified the victim of an overnight hit and run crash as 52-year-old Gloria Valdez. 

According to an LPD press release, investigators located a car matching the description of the car from the crash and impounded it around 9:00 a.m. Wednesday morning. However, no suspect has been arrested. 

Police said the crash remains under investigation by the LPD Major Crash Investigation Unit.

The following is a press release from the Lubbock Police Department: 

The female pedestrian killed in last night’s hit and run crash has been identified as 52-year-old Gloria Valdez.

Early this morning, Lubbock Police Department major crash investigators began searching several areas for the suspect vehicle. Just before 9 a.m., investigators located a 1999 Chevrolet Suburban believed to be the suspect vehicle. The Suburban was parked in the parking lot of Motel 6 located at 909 66th Street and was impounded.

This crash remains under investigation by the LPD Major Crash Investigation Unit.
